Specs:
  • AMD Ryzen 9 5900 Processor (12-Core, 70MB Total Cache, Max Boost Clock of 4.7GHz)
  • 16GB DDR4 3200MHz Memory
  • 1TB M.2 PCIe NVMe Solid State Drive
  • N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3080 10GB GDDR6X LHR Graphics Card
  • Lunar Light chassis with High-Performance CPU Liquid Cooling and 1000W Power Supply
  • Dell Wireless DW1810 (1x1) 802.11ac with Wi-Fi, Wireless LAN + Bluetooth 5.0
  • Keyboard + Optical Mouse
  • Windows 11 Home
  • Front Ports:
    • 2 x Type-A USB 3.2 Gen 1
    • 1 x Type-A USB 3.2 Gen 1 Ports with Powershare technology
    • 1 x Type-C USB 3.2 Gen 1 Ports with Powershare technology
    • 1 x Headphone/Line Out | 5. Microphone/Line In
  • Rear Ports:
    • 1 x SPDIF Digital Output (Coax)
    • 1 x SPDIF Digital Output (TOSLINK)
    • 1 x RJ-45 Killer E2600 Gigabit Ethernet
    • 6 x Type-A USB 2.0 Ports
    • 1 x Type-C USB 3.2 Gen 2 with Powershare technology (up to 15W)
    • 1 x Type-A USB 3.2 Gen 2
    • 1 x Side Surround Output
    • 1 x Microphone In
    • 1 x Line Out
    • 3 x Type-A USB 3.2 Gen 1
    • 1 x Rear Surround Output
    • 1 x Center/Subwoofer Output
    • 1 x Line in
